Mumbai: MMRDA to start construction of 5 metro lines in December 2017

Mumbai is soon to witness less congested local trains and fast moving vehicular traffic. Thanks to MMRDA’s plan to bring the far end suburb’s close to the heart of the city. Apart from the ongoing metro construction work, MMRDA also plans to start construction work on five Metro corridors in Mumbai by December 2017.
According to a report in Times of India, MMRDA plans to start construction work in the following areas- DN Nagar-Mankhurd; WadalaGhatkopar-Mulund-Kasarvadavli; Thane-BhiwandiKalyan; Swami Samarthnagar-Jogeshwari-Kanjurmarg-Vikhroli, and Dahisar East-Mira Road-Bhayander. Presently, these areas rely on local trains and road transportation. Introduction of metro corridor is expected to boost connectivity across these rapidly expanding Mumbai suburbs.
